The Role
The Operations Manager for the Maintenance department (Roofing, Damp & Restorations) oversees the delivery of high-quality maintenance projects across London, ensuring exceptional service standards and operational efficiency. This role involves managing teams across multiple divisions, coordinating schedules, monitoring costs, and maintaining compliance with health and safety regulations.
The role holds day-to-day operational ownership of job setup, resourcing, diary management, staff performance, cost control and compliance, ensuring works are delivered safely, on programme, and to the company’s exacting standards.
The ideal candidate will be a strong leader with hands-on experience in roofing, damp proofing, and restoration works, capable of driving performance, developing teams, and ensuring projects are delivered on time, within budget, and to the company’s exacting standards.
The Operations Manager is expected to be visible across live sites, proactively troubleshoot issues, protect margin, and uphold the company’s non‑negotiable weekly operational controls.
Minimum Requirements:
Must reside within 1-hour travel from Fulham, SW London area.
Full UK driving licence required.
Minimum 5-7 years of proven experience in property maintenance, construction, or property restoration management.
Minimum of 5 years of proven experience in roofing, damp proofing, or restoration environments is essential – experience in all three is strongly preferred.
Minimum 3-5 years of team management experience, leading multidisciplinary crews (Surveyors, Roofers, Damp Specialists, Restorers, Coordinators and Labourers).
Strong technical understanding of roofing systems, damp proofing methods, and heritage/restoration practices.
Formal qualification in Construction Management, Building Maintenance, or a related field (preferred but not essential).
SMSTS / SSSTS, IOSH, or equivalent Health & Safety certification highly desirable.
Demonstrated experience in managing multiple projects simultaneously, ensuring delivery to time, cost, and quality standards.
Strong understanding of building regulations, HSE standards, and industry best practices in roofing and damp restoration.
Proficiency in project reporting, budget tracking, and performance analysis.
Competent in using CRM/project management software and job tracking systems.
Proven ability to foster a positive, safety-driven, and performance-based team culture.
Skilled in coaching, performance management, and staff development to support progression and maintain high standards.
Experience in client-facing roles, managing expectations, resolving issues, and maintaining long-term relationships.
Sound understanding of budget management, cost tracking, and profitability metrics.
Duties & Responsibilities:
Service Delivery & Standards:
* Ensures that maintenance services, including roofing, damp, and restoration projects, are delivered to the highest standards, reflecting the company’s reputation for excellence in complex and large-scale projects.
* Regularly reviews and updates service protocols to ensure compliance with health, safety, and building regulations, maintaining a strong focus on safety and quality.
* Works closely with coordinators to ensure smooth scheduling and effective project management, ensuring projects are completed on time and to the clients’ satisfaction.
* Ensures all projects are fully set up and ready to commence, including confirmed start dates, labour allocations, material orders, access arrangements, and clear job instructions for EPS teams and subcontractors.
* Maintains operational oversight across all live projects, ensuring progress is tracked, issues are escalated immediately, and quality is verified prior to sign‑off.
Operational Efficiency:
* Continuously identifies opportunities for process improvements, including optimising resource allocation, scheduling teams effectively, and implementing efficient work practices to enhance productivity. Develops strategies to maximise the time crews spend on site, minimising downtime, and ensuring that all work hours contribute directly to project goals.
